Joe Anthony Gatto, born on June 5, 1976, in Staten Island, New York, is of Italian descent. He attended Monsignor Farrell High School and later graduated from LIU Post with a degree in accounting. Gatto’s journey into comedy began when he co-founded the comedy troupe The Tenderloins in 1999 with his high school friends. This group would later become the foundation for his career in television.

As of 2024, Joe Gatto’s net worth is estimated to be around $7 million. This figure is a result of his successful career in comedy, particularly through his work on “Impractical Jokers,” which premiered on truTV in 2011. The show quickly gained popularity, and Gatto, along with his fellow cast members, earned approximately $50,000 per episode. The overall valuation of the show and its actors is around $20 million, with each of the four main cast members, including Gatto, valued at about $5 million.

Early Life and Family

Joe Gatto was raised in a close-knit Italian-American family. His parents, Gerri Amato-Gatto and Joseph Gatto Sr., immigrated to the United States before his birth. Tragically, his father passed away in 1995. Gatto married Bessy Gatto in 2013, and the couple welcomed two children, a daughter named Milana and a son named Remington. However, in December 2021, they announced their divorce, which Gatto cited as a reason for stepping back from “Impractical Jokers.”

Career Highlights

Gatto’s career took off with the formation of The Tenderloins, which gained recognition for their live improv performances. The group won a $100,000 grand prize on the NBC reality competition “It’s Your Show,” which helped propel them into the spotlight. In 2011, they launched “Impractical Jokers,” a hidden camera comedy show that features the four members challenging each other to embarrassing dares in public. The show’s success led to a feature film, “Impractical Jokers: The Movie,” released in 2020.

In addition to “Impractical Jokers,” Gatto has appeared on other shows, including “The Misery Index,” and has co-hosted the podcast “Two Cool Moms” with comedian Steve Byrne. He also founded Cannoli Productions in 2018, a company that helps individuals and businesses achieve their project goals.

Income Sources

Joe Gatto’s primary source of income comes from his work in television and comedy. His salary from “Impractical Jokers” significantly contributed to his net worth. Beyond television, Gatto has diversified his income through various ventures:

  • Stand-Up Comedy: Gatto continues to perform stand-up comedy and is currently on a U.S. tour.
  • Podcasting: His podcast “Two Cool Moms” has gained popularity, allowing him to reach a broader audience.
  • Cameo: Gatto offers personalized video messages on Cameo, charging around $229 per video.
  • Real Estate: In 2018, Gatto purchased a mansion in Old Brookville, New York, for $2.7 million.

Personal Life and Recent Developments

After announcing his departure from “Impractical Jokers” in December 2021, Gatto focused on his personal life and co-parenting his children. In 2023, rumors of reconciliation with his ex-wife Bessy surfaced, and they confirmed their renewed relationship in September 2023. Gatto expressed gratitude for their journey together and emphasized the importance of family.
